Lumding-Silchar train services resume



GUWAHATI/SILCHAR: After 18 hours, train services on the Lumding-Silchar section resumed at 12 noon on Tuesday.

All trains on the route were cancelled after two engines and a compartment of an empty freight train got derailed between Lower Haflong and Migrendisa stations in Dima Hasao district on Monday evening after suspected miscreants removed fishplates from the tracks. A total of 26 metres of railway tracks was damaged and the miscreants also manhandled two drivers of the train.

The railway men worked overnight to remove the derailed engines and compartment and repaired the tracks. All trains have started plying from Tuesday noon.

Northeast Frontier Railway PRO N Bhattacharjee said, "All long-distance trains leaving for Dibrugarh from Guwahati station and those which are leaving Dibrugarh are running late due to security reasons. Pilot or escort trains are moving in front of long-distance trains in the troubled Karbi Anglong and BTC areas to provide security."

NF Railway authorities said two short-distance passenger trains are likely to be cancelled on Wednesday due to technical reasons.

Reports from Haflong said life in the district was crippled on the second day of the 100-hour bandh on Tuesday. People remained indoors as all shops, markets, schools, government and private offices remained closed.

Hill State Democratic Party (HSDP) and some Dimasa social organizations called the bandh since 5 am on Monday seeking a separate state comprising Dima Hasao and Karbi Anglong districts.

The administration has promulgated Section 144 CrPc in the district to thwart any trouble during the 100-hour bandh and also on the eve of Independence Day.
